METHODS FOR FABRICATING ELECTRODE AND MEA FOR FUEL CELL |
摘要 |
PURPOSE: A method for fabricating an electrode for a fuel cell is provided to reduce the used amount of a catalyst because the effective surface area of catalyst is increased, and to be easily introduced within a porous conductive film even when the density of the porous conductive film. CONSTITUTION: A method for fabricating an electrode for a fuel cell comprises the steps of: modifying some of the upper part of a porous conductive film(10) to have polarity; and introducing a catalyst layer(13) on a porous conductive membrane in which the partial upper part is modified. A method for manufacturing a membrane electrode assembly comprises the steps of: introducing a first catalyst layer on a porous conductive film in which the partial upper part is modified; providing a reducing electrode; and installing the oxidizing electrode and reducing electrode at both sides of an ion exchange film. |
